如何在 react-slick 中将类添加到 li 标签

Posted

技术标签:

【中文标题】如何在 react-slick 中将类添加到 li 标签【英文标题】:How to add class to li tag in react-slick 【发布时间】:2020-04-26 08:25:02 【问题描述】:

我正在使用react-slick 库。我检查了 API docs,但没有找到任何设置 li 标签类的道具。

如何添加我的自定义类名?

【问题讨论】:

react docs 是否没有很好地涵盖样式?请更新您的问题以包含Minimal, Complete, and Reproducible 代码示例以及有关哪些内容不起作用以及您的预期结果应该是什么的详细信息。正如所写,目前尚不清楚问题是什么。 【参考方案1】:

您应该将自定义 className 添加到包装器中,然后在您的 CSS 文件中选择 li 子级并注入您的样式,如下所示:

const settings = 
  className: 'customName', // <== your custom name
  dots: true,
  infinite: true,
  speed: 500,
  slidesToShow: 1,
  slidesToScroll: 1
;

在你的 CSS 文件中:

.customName li 
  border: 1px solid red; /* it's just an example */

【讨论】:

以上是关于如何在 react-slick 中将类添加到 li 标签的主要内容,如果未能解决你的问题,请参考以下文章

如何向 [react-slick] 添加支持触摸的灯箱功能?

ul和分配类中li的数量

如何在 WordPress 中将类添加到自定义侧边栏

如果li在react功能组件中具有活动类,如何将类添加到父元素ul

React-slick 修改

如何将类添加到 wp_nav_menu 中的某些 li 元素